Mitzi Zeri has been a very successful realtor and broker for over 27 years. As the owner and principal broker of Enchanted Homes Realty, she specializes in residential properties and loves connecting buyers and sellers to their dream homes. She is also very passionate about coaching real estate professionals, and has been training, mentoring and coaching for the past 18 years. Well known in her field for her leadership and high energy, Mitzi holds a bachelor's degree in Business Administration from the University of Albuquerque, class of 1984. her affiliations are vast, and include the National Society of the Colonial Dames of America, Mayflower Society, National Huguenot Society, Daughters of the American Revolution, and the National Society Magna Charta Dames. Mitzi is committed to continuous learning and holds multiple designations, and is currently working on another. She has been very active at both the local and state level of the Realtor association and has held nearly all positions of leadership. Outside of managing her brokerage, she is a full time coach with Tom Ferry International.
